Apple t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ping apple trees to promote healthy growth and maximize fruit production. This process typically includes removing dead, diseased, or damaged branches, as well as thinning out crowded areas to improve air circulation and sunlight exposure. Proper pruning helps maintain the tree’s structure, reduces the risk of branch breakage, and encourages the development of strong, productive fruiting wood. Local contractors skilled in orchard and landscape pruning can tailor their techniques to the specific needs of apple trees, ensuring they remain healthy and fruitful year after year.
Pruning services are especially helpful for addressing common problems such as overgrown branches that can hinder growth, or diseased limbs that threaten the overall health of the tree. It can also prevent issues like branch crossing or rubbing, which can cause wounds and invite pests or infections. For homeowners with mature apple trees or those planting new ones, regular pruning helps maintain the tree’s shape and vigor. Additionally, pruning can improve the safety of a property by removing heavy or weak branches that pose a risk of falling, especially during storms or high winds.

The overview below groups typical Apple Tree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Pickerington, OH.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Tree Pruning - Typical costs range from $150 to $400 for routine trimming of smaller trees in Pickerington, OH. Many local contractors handle these standard jobs within this range, which covers shaping and removing dead branches.
Medium Tree Pruning - For larger, more established trees, prices generally fall between $400 and $1,200. These projects often involve more extensive work and can vary based on tree size and complexity, with fewer jobs reaching the higher end.
Heavy Branch Removal - Removing large, hazardous branches or storm-damaged limbs can cost from $300 to $800 per project. Many projects in this category are mid-range, but larger or more complex removals can exceed $1,000.
Full Tree Shaping or Crown Reduction - Comprehensive pruning or crown reduction services typically range from $600 to $2,500. Larger, more intricate projects can go beyond this, but most fall within the middle of this spectrum based on tree size and scope.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the benefits of pruning apple trees? Proper pruning can improve fruit production, promote healthy growth, and maintain the overall shape of the tree.
When is the best time to prune apple trees? The ideal time for pruning is typically during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
How do professional contractors handle apple tree pruning? Local service providers use techniques to remove dead or overgrown branches, enhance airflow, and support tree health.
Can pruning help prevent disease in apple trees? Yes, proper pruning can reduce the risk of disease by increasing airflow and removing infected or damaged branches.
What tools are used for apple tree pruning? Experienced contractors often use pruning shears, loppers, and saws to carefully trim branches and shape the tree.
